Pada Git, untuk melakukan git fetch dan git push dengan ahli projek lain, ' asal usul ” dan “ tuan ” repositori boleh digunakan. origin dan master ialah dua istilah berbeza yang digunakan semasa mengusahakan dan mengurus projek Git. Lebih khusus lagi, asal ialah nama lalai yang diberikan kepada repositori jauh Git; walau bagaimanapun, induk ialah nama cawangan Git.
Blog ini akan membincangkan cawangan induk asal Git.
Bagaimana untuk Menukar, Mengambil dan Menolak Origin Master?
Untuk menukar cawangan, ambil dan tolak cawangan tempatan ke jauh; pertama, pindah ke direktori akar Git dan buat repositori baharu. Kemudian, klon repositori dan lihat asal jauh atau senarai sambungan jauh dengan melaksanakan ' $ git remote -v ” perintah. Seterusnya, tukar ke cawangan yang diperlukan.
Mari kita teruskan dan lakukan secara praktikal prosedur yang dinyatakan di atas!
Langkah 1: Beralih ke Direktori Root Git
Mula-mula, pindah ke direktori akar Git menggunakan ' cd ” perintah:
$ cd 'C:\Users \n azma\Go'
Langkah 2: Buat Repositori
Jalankan ' mkdir ” perintah untuk mencipta repositori baharu:
$ mkdir Demo1
Langkah 3: Repositori Klon
Klonkan repositori jauh dengan menggunakan ' git klon ” perintah dan tentukan URL repositori jauh:
$ git klon https: // github.com / GitUser0422 / demo3.git
Langkah 4: Semak Asal Jauh
Jalankan ' git jauh ” perintah untuk melihat asal jauh:
$ git jauh -dalamOutput yang diberikan memaparkan senarai sambungan jauh:
Langkah 5: Tukar Cawangan
Seterusnya, beralih ke cawangan induk dengan menggunakan arahan yang disediakan:
$ git suis induk
Langkah 6: Ambil Cawangan
Sekarang, muat turun cawangan induk jauh ke repositori tempatan menggunakan ' git fetch ” perintah:
$ git merge asal usul / tuan
Langkah 7: Gabungkan Cawangan Jauh
Laksanakan ' git merge ” perintah untuk menggabungkan cawangan tempatan ke cawangan terpencil:
$ git merge asal usul / tuan --benarkan-sejarah-tidak berkaitan
Langkah 8: Jalankan Perintah git push
Sekarang, tolak cawangan induk yang dikemas kini ke repositori jauh melalui arahan berikut:
$ git push tuan asal
Kami telah menerangkan tentang master asal Git dengan contoh.
Kesimpulan
Dalam Git, asal dan induk adalah dua istilah berbeza. Asal ialah nama lalai yang diberikan kepada repositori jauh Git; walau bagaimanapun, induk ialah nama cawangan Git. Untuk melihat asal jauh, laksanakan “ $ git remote -v ” perintah. Selain itu, ' $ git checkout